Abstract | This textbook is a third-year high school mathematics course and is the third of the series of textbooks on secondary mathematics. It completes the study of high-school algebra, trigonometry, and solid geometry. The features of this course are: (1) Reviews are carried on at frequent intervals throughout the course; (2) At the end of each chapter the principal facts are summarized; (3) The last chapter of the book is a syllabus of all the theorems of plane and solid geometry which were studied in the preceding courses; (4) The material has been carefully selected with a view to stimulating independent thinking and to preparing the student for collegiate mathematics; and (5) The historical notes distributed throughout the book add to the interest of the student in genetic phases of the work.
